Whiskey Creek Vegetation Management Project

Medicine Bow-Routt National Forests & Thunder Basin National Grassland Routt, Colorado Hahns Peak/Bears Ears Ranger District

Removal of downed or standing dead spruce and fir trees affected by a severe wind event which occurred on September 8, 2020.

Location

Hahns Peak/Bears Ears Ranger District of the Medicine Bow-Routt National Forest and Thunder Basin National Grassland in Routt County, Colorado, approximately 35 miles northwest of Steamboat Spring.
